HONOR has unveiled a redesigned corporate identity for 2026, including a new Ring of HONOR logo and the slogan Dare to Be. The company says the refresh reflects its ambition to move beyond being primarily a smartphone manufacturer and become a broader AI-device ecosystem brand. That direction includes future work around an Agentic OS, connected hardware and services intended to operate more intelligently across phones, tablets, wearables and other products.

Brand changes can appear superficial, but they often signal a wider strategic shift, particularly for a company seeking to compete with Apple, Samsung, Huawei and emerging AI-focused platforms. HONOR will need to support the new identity with products and software that demonstrate clear benefits rather than relying on abstract promises about intelligence and connectivity.

The Ring of HONOR symbol is designed to provide a recognisable visual anchor across the company's expanding portfolio, while Dare to Be positions the brand around confidence and experimentation. The challenge will be maintaining consistency as HONOR serves very different markets and price segments. For consumers, the immediate effect is mostly visual, but the announcement gives useful context for upcoming devices and software.

It suggests future HONOR launches will be presented less as isolated gadgets and more as parts of a connected, AI-driven ecosystem.
